Abstract
The photodimerization reaction of pendant thymine bases in thymine‐containing poly‐lysine derivatives was studied over a wide range in aqueous solution. It was found that the quantum yield of the photodimerization of pendant thymine bases is affected mainly by the conformation of the polymers in solution. The differences in photoreaction behavior were discussed for poly‐D‐, poly‐L‐, and poly‐DL‐lysine derivatives.
